fiz uma sp de consulta como mostro o resultado na delphi 7

Delphi

13/05/2008

Olá
fiz uma sp que busca determinado cliente mas ñ sei como faço para mostrar os resultados no delphi estou usando os componentes mdo.


Ivespas

Ivespas

Curtidas 0

Respostas

Paulo

Paulo

13/05/2008

Pode mostrar num grid. Se for ADO, use o componente ADOStoredProc(Palheta ADO ou dbGO>>2007), se for DBExpress, SqlStoredProc e se for BDE use StoredProc. Ligue um DataSource a um desses componentes e um Grid ao DataSource. Agora quanto a navegabilidade não sei, o da DBExpress seria ter um ClientDataSet, Um provider ao componente, pois o DBX é unidirecional. Axo que é isso, caso faltou alguma coisa e quem souber de uma ajudinha aí pro companheiro, mas axo que é só isso.


GOSTEI 0
Pestana_

Pestana_

13/05/2008

Pode mostrar num grid. Se for ADO, use o componente ADOStoredProc(Palheta ADO ou dbGO>>2007), se for DBExpress, SqlStoredProc e se for BDE use StoredProc. Ligue um DataSource a um desses componentes e um Grid ao DataSource


é isso mesmo?


flw.


GOSTEI 0
Emerson Nascimento

Emerson Nascimento

13/05/2008

faça um select, pois as stored procedures que retornam resultado - chamadas selecionáveis - são tratadas como tabelas.

inclusive aceitando as cláusulas where e todas as demais de um comando select padrão.

supondo que sua SP receba dois parâmetros e retorne os campos Campo1, Campo2 e Campo3, a instrução poderia ser:
select * from SP( param1, param2 ) where Campo1 = ValorX;


GOSTEI 0
Emerson Nascimento

Emerson Nascimento

13/05/2008

só pra complementar, minha resposta te serve somente se o seu banco de dados for Firebird ou Interbase.


GOSTEI 0
POSTAR